GM BCM Cloning — Troubleshooting Guide (SKU Group)
Important: Use this guide if you reinstalled your repaired (GM BCM Cloning) module and the problem is still happening.
Important: Please do not open/disassemble the BCM or force/probe connector pins (terminal damage can cause new faults).
- Step 1: Confirm the correct module was installed
- Verify the BCM matches the vehicle/application (correct donor/replacement BCM type for that model).
- Make sure the same BCM location is used (some GM platforms have multiple “modules” customers call a BCM).
- Step 2: Battery voltage and clean power-up
- Fully charge the battery before install.
- Key OFF, connect BCM, then key ON and wait 60–90 seconds before cranking (modules need time to wake and handshake).
- Step 3: Check BCM fuses and main feeds
- Check all BCM/IGN/ACC fuses (under-hood + interior).
- Confirm any BCM/IGN relay clicks/activates.
- A single blown IGN/BCM fuse can cause no-start, dead cluster, no comms, or random electrical issues.
- Step 4: Grounds matter
- Inspect/clean battery terminals and the main chassis/engine grounds.
- If symptoms are intermittent, do a quick wiggle test at grounds and the BCM connector area.
- Step 5: Connector seating and terminal condition
- Ensure connectors are fully seated and locked.
- Look for bent pins, backed-out terminals, corrosion, or moisture in the plugs.
- If prior electrical work was done, re-check what was touched (fuse box, battery, grounds, splices).
- Step 6: If you have “No Communication”
- Confirm the scan tool talks to other modules.
- If many modules are offline, suspect vehicle network/power issue (battery, main fuses, CAN wiring).
- If only the BCM is offline, focus on BCM power/ground circuits and connector integrity.
- Step 7: If the vehicle will not start
- Watch the security indicator behavior.
- Many no-starts after BCM work are caused by:
- Low voltage
- Missed fuse/IGN feed
- Poor ground
- Incorrect donor BCM type
- Vehicle-side wiring/connector problems
- Step 8: If locks/lights/wipers act weird
- Confirm the vehicle is not in transport/valet mode (if applicable).
- Re-scan for body/U-codes and note which modules are complaining (helps isolate wiring vs module).
- Step 9: When to involve a shop
- If the above checks don’t resolve it, a shop should perform:
- Voltage-drop testing on BCM power/ground under load
- Network integrity checks (CAN high/low resistance and continuity)
- Terminal tension testing at BCM connectors (no pin spreading)
